  • Momodu Gondo on Committing Robbery, Drug Trafficking & Fraud as a Baltimore Cop
    Sep 5 2025

    Momodu Gondo, a former Baltimore Police Department detective, discussed his involvement in a major corruption scandal involving the Gun Trace Task Force. Gondo detailed his parents' migration from Sierra Leone, his education, and his entry into law enforcement. He recounted being shot while on duty, the subsequent trial where the shooter was acquitted, and his subsequent corruption, including participating in robberies and faking overtime. Gondo admitted to stealing money from search warrants and other illegal activities. He was eventually arrested, pleaded guilty to conspiracy to distribute narcotics and racketeering, and received a 10-year sentence. Momodu Gondo discussed his experiences in prison, emphasizing his mindset of operating at a high level and never getting into violent incidents. He noted that he was respected despite being a former detective and robbing dealers. Gondo mentioned the 2022 HBO mini-series "We Own the City," which depicted his actions, and the $22 million settlement Baltimore paid in lawsuits. Post-release, he faced challenges as a felon but found success in fitness, earning more than he did in law enforcement. Gondo stressed the importance of making positive choices and impacting others positively.

  • Hernandez Govan's 1st Interview Since Being Found Not Guilty of Young Dolph Murder
    Sep 4 2025

    Hernandez Govan, found not guilty of first-degree murder and conspiracy for the killing of Young Dolph, discussed his background, including a 26-year criminal history and relationships with Dolph and Yo Gotti. He denied any involvement in Dolph's murder, asserting that he was framed by Cornelius Smith and Straight Drop, who were reportedly promised $100,000 for the hit. Govan's lawyer, Manny Aurora, highlighted inconsistencies in Smith's testimony and the lack of incriminating evidence.
